Marc Chagall
Chagall's appeal is in the way in which he brings joy to the awkward everyday. For example, embracing newly-weds floating from the sky, strange creatures playing the clarinet or violin, the sun and moon melting into one another as they smile. Chagall is probably the first painter to produce such light, beautiful imagery.

However, what do these paintings really mean? Chagall has once spoken the words "If I have a hiding place in my paintings, I will slip my autobiography there", but the fragments of his life hidden in his paintings are not something that can be easily understood by merely looking at them.

This exhibition aims to deepen the understanding of Chagall by focusing on love, a significant theme that he has expressed in his paintings.
